United Way Now Offering Free Virtual Tax Preparation Service

Richmond, Va. (May 19, 2020) – With the federal tax-filing deadline extended to July 15, and Virginians receiving an extension for state returns, United Way of Greater Richmond & Petersburg is offering free virtual tax preparation services to households with incomes below $66,000.

Traditionally, the Volunteer Income Tax Assistance (VITA) program is held at 16 tax sites across the region, but as a result of the COVID-19 pandemic, the nonprofit has shifted its focus to assisting taxpayers virtually until the tax sites can safely be reopened.

United Way partnered with Code for America to bring GetYourRefund to the region, allowing its local team of IRS-certified volunteer tax preparers to virtually assist taxpayers with completing and electronically filing both federal and state returns. To utilize the program, participants need just a smart phone with a camera or a computer with access to a scanner.

The program also encourages people to think about ways to save, implement financial best practices and make plans for achieving financial independence. And for those with low to moderate income, the service helps eligible taxpayers take advantage of potential tax savings through the Earned Income Tax Credit (EITC).

“For many around the region, the last few months have been difficult to navigate, but we’re pleased to be able to ease some of the anxiety and stress that those who haven’t filed yet might be feeling,” said James Taylor, president & CEO of United Way of Greater Richmond & Petersburg. “We knew a shift to virtual preparation was important because this service has made a tangible difference for local families over the past 10 years, particularly for those who have taken advantage of the Earned Income Tax Credit.”

In 2019, local United Way volunteers helped secure more than $3 million in tax refunds for 3,667 households in our area. Families who took advantage of the service received a total of $838,300 in EITC funds from the IRS. The average household income for customers was $22,900.

Online Tax Prep Also Available

United Way’s MyFreeTaxes.com service provides another convenient tax preparation method for households of any income level with simple (no schedule A, C, D, or E) federal and state tax returns. The program is a free, safe and easy way for individuals and families to file taxes online.

MyFreeTaxes.com manages both federal and state returns and is powered by H&R Block. Tax returns with schedule A, C, D, or E can be prepared for a small fee.
